~alextee/zrythm

19fd874259f821394235dd911ca3fa2ced74906b — Alexandros Theodotou 2 years ago bab6429 bugfixes
fix crash when changing marker track color

Fixes https://todo.sr.ht/~alextee/zrythm-bug/483.
2 files changed, 9 insertions(+), 3 deletions(-)

M INSTALL.md
M src/gui/backend/event_manager.c
M INSTALL.md => INSTALL.md +4 -2
@@ 55,11 55,13 @@ with meaningful stack traces and bug reports.
- reproc (Expat): <https://github.com/DaanDeMeyer/reproc>
- zstd (3-Clause BSD): <https://github.com/facebook/zstd>

### Optional
### Recommended
- carla (GPLv2+): <https://kx.studio/Applications:Carla>
- graphviz (EPLv1.0): <http://graphviz.org/>
- jack (LGPLv2.1+): <https://jackaudio.org/>
- lsp-dsp-lib (LGPLv3+): <https://github.com/sadko4u/lsp-dsp-lib>

### Optional
- graphviz (EPLv1.0): <http://graphviz.org/>
- rtaudio (Expat): <http://www.music.mcgill.ca/~gary/rtaudio/>
- rtmidi (Expat): <https://www.music.mcgill.ca/~gary/rtmidi/>
- SDL2 (zlib): <https://www.libsdl.org/>

M src/gui/backend/event_manager.c => src/gui/backend/event_manager.c +5 -1
@@ 848,7 848,11 @@ on_mixer_selections_changed ()
static void
on_track_color_changed (Track * track)
{
  channel_widget_refresh (track->channel->widget);
  if (track_type_has_channel (track->type))
    {
      channel_widget_refresh (
        track->channel->widget);
    }
  track_widget_force_redraw (track->widget);
  left_dock_edge_widget_refresh (
    MW_LEFT_DOCK_EDGE);